What You Will Need:

This is what you will need to add to your grocery list to make this strawberry cream cheese icebox cake recipe:

  • 3, 3.4-ounce boxes of instant pudding cheesecake mix
  • 4 cups cold milk- at least 1% milk, not skim milk
  • 8 ounce whipped topping
  • 16 ounces of graham crackers
  • 4 cups strawberries

How to Level Up This Recipe

While this is a perfectly delicious recipe if made as directed, you can easily add more to it if you want to switch it up. Some ideas are:

  1. Make it a red, white, and blue graham cracker cake by adding in some blueberries. This would be perfect for a Fourth of July party.
  2. Freeze it! It tastes like ice cream with graham crackers in it!!
  3. Assemble it in a trifle dish to make it appear just a little more fancy!

Making Ahead and Storage

This recipe can be made at least a day in advance of when you will be serving it. Any longer and the graham crackers get soggy and the strawberries will start weeping juice.

Store this icebox graham cracker cake in an air-tight container in the refrigerator for 2-3 days. This can also be frozen for up to 3 months.

Strawberry Icebox Cake

Sweet layers of graham crackers, cheesecake pudding, whipped topping and strawberries make up this no bake strawberry graham cracker icebox cake.
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time0 minutes
Chill Time3 hours
Servings: 12
Calories: 268kcal

Ingredients

  • 3 3.4 ounce boxes Instant pudding cheesecake mix
  • 4 cups cold milk
  • 8 ounces whipped topping
  • 16 ounces graham crackers
  • 4 cups strawberries washed and sliced

Instructions

  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the pudding mix and cold milk. Mix until well combined. Fold in the whipped topping.
  • Place a layer of graham crackers on the bottom of a 9 x 13 inch pan.
  • Spread a layer of cheesecake pudding over the crackers. Sprinkle on sliced strawberries.
  • Place another layer of crackers on top, then pudding and strawberries.
  • Add the last layer of crackers, pudding and strawberries. Cover and refrigerate at least 3 hours until set.
